Don't know if you know how to score, but I gave him the following guesstimates.

right beam - 17"
right G1 - 2"
right G2 - 9"
right G3 - 4
right H1 - 4"
right H2 - 3.25"
right H3 - 3"

Total - 42.25"

leftbeam - 17"
left G1 - 3"
left G2 - 8"
left G3 - 5"
left H1 - 4"
left H2 - 3.25"
left H3 - 3"

Total - 43.25"

I gave him 16" for spread. According to my guesses, he would end up at 101.5" My final guess would be between 100-105".

For comparison sakes, this is my personal best buck and he measured 89". Yours has longer G3's and browtines and is wider.
